Iona Baseball Secures First MAAC Win, Defeats Manhattan 7-2 Behind Standout Performances
Iona University's baseball team secured their first MAAC win by defeating Manhattan 7-2 after a strong start with four runs in the first two innings. Senior James Kemp led the offense with two hits, including a home run and four RBIs, while junior Andrelys Payamps impressed with a career-high eight strikeouts. The Gaels outperformed the Jaspers with a 9-6 hit margin at Westchester Community College.
By the Numbers- Sophomore Anthony Zollo registered his eighth multi-hit game of the season.
- Junior Andrelys Payamps achieved a career-high eight strikeouts in five innings of work.
- Senior James Kemp hit his fifth career home run in the seventh inning.

State of Play- Junior Jayson Gonzalez extended his hitting streak to 10 straight games.
- Senior Alex Hunt, along with juniors Eric Gialloreto and Matt Zguro, held the Jaspers hitless in the final two innings.
- Both teams will battle for the series win in the finale tomorrow at Westchester Community College.
